Things to do in Rochester?
Rochester, New York is a vibrant city with plenty of attractions for everyone. Nature lovers can explore the scenic Genesee River or take a hike at Durand Eastman Park. History buffs should check out sites like the George Eastman Museum to learn more about the area's past. Sports fans can catch a game at Frontier Field, while foodies can sample all kinds of delicious eats throughout town. Shopping lovers should visit The Marketplace at Oxbridge or Pittsford Plaza for good deals on all kinds of items. With its rich culture and exciting activities, Rochester is an incredible place to visit!
